Rurema v Uganda (Criminal Appeal 185 of 2011)

Citation: [2024] UGCA 254 Court: Court of Appeal Decided: 2 September 2024 Jurisdiction: Uganda

Held that the Court of Appeal will not reduce a 22-year sentence for aggravated defilement where the trial judge properly balanced aggravating and mitigating factors.
